a bottle of a right cylindrical shaped vessels made from metallic sheet is closed by a cone shaped vessel as shown in figure the radius of the circular base of the cylinder and radius of the circular base of the cone are equal is equal to 7 cm if the height of the cylinder is 20 cm and height of cone is 3 cm calculate the cost of milk to fill completely the special @ rupees 20 per litre​

Answer:

Step-by-step explanation:

Volume of cylinder = π R²h

R = 7cm

h = 20 cm

= (22/7)(7²)(20)

= 154 * 20

= 3080 cm³

Bottom is closed by cone so cone would be inside

Volume of cone = (1/3)π R²h

R = 7 cm

h = 3 cm

=(1/3)(22/7)(7²)(3)

= 154 cm³

Volume of vessel = Volume  of cylinder - volume of cone

= 3080 - 154 = 2926 cm³

1 litre = 1000 cm³

2926 cm³ = 2.926 Litr

Cost of Milk = Rs 20 per litre

Cost of milk = 20 * 2.926 =  Rs  58.52
